MYMENSINGH, June 12, 2021 (BSS) – State Minister for Cultural Affairs KM Khalid today said no one will remain homeless in the country.

“None will remain homeless in the country as the present government, led by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ina, is gradually providing houses to the country’s homeless and landless people,” he said while visiting under construction houses for the homeless people at Kumergata area under Muktagachha upazila of the district this noon.

The state minister said the distribution of houses among the homeless families is a rare and historic initiative of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ina and her government.

Through her initiative landless and homeless people of the country have been getting semi pucca houses, he said.

After visiting the construction works, he expressed satisfaction over the works. He urged the concerned to complete the work within stipulated time.

UNO office sources said, 11 houses are being constructed at a cost of around Taka 22 lakh.

Later, Khalid visited constructed houses and talked to the beneficiaries. The beneficiaries have expressed gratitude to the Prime Minister for providing them houses.
